Wagering Requirements: The Real Cost of Free Money

Let’s do the math. You get £10 free. Wagering is 45x. That’s £450 in bets. If you play a slot with 96% RTP, your expected loss over that wagering is around £18. So statistically, you’re more likely to lose the bonus than to profit from it. But that’s the nature of these offers. You need a bit of luck.

Some players hit a big win early. I’ve seen screenshots of people turning the £10 into £200 within a few spins. But then the max cashout cap of £100 kicks in. So even if you win £200, you only get £100. That’s the trade-off.

One trick? Look for slots with high volatility and a max win potential above 5,000x. Games like ‘Money Train 3’ or ‘Dead or Alive 2’ can give you that one big hit. But they’re also riskier. You might burn through the £10 in 20 spins.
